Kosher Certification in Malaysia: Building Global Trust Through Food Integrity
Understanding the Growing Demand for Kosher Standards
Kosher certification is gaining strong momentum in Malaysia as more food manufacturers and exporters recognize the value of meeting global religious and quality requirements. While kosher traditionally refers to food that complies with Jewish dietary laws, its reach has expanded far beyond religious consumers. Today, kosher-certified products are preferred worldwide for their strict hygiene, traceability, and ingredient transparency. For Malaysian businesses, obtaining kosher certification is a strategic move that opens doors to international markets, including the United States, Europe, and the Middle East.

Key Benefits of Kosher Certification for Malaysian Producers
Achieving kosher certification comes with multiple strategic advantages. First, it significantly expands market access by allowing products to enter kosher-sensitive regions and specialized retail segments. Second, the certification process promotes better manufacturing practices by enforcing clean production lines, precise ingredient sourcing, and strict cross-contamination controls. This leads to improved overall quality, even for non-kosher markets. Third, kosher certification enhances product traceability, helping businesses meet global expectations for safety and transparency—an increasingly important factor for modern consumers and international partners.
How to Obtain Kosher Certification in Malaysia
The certification process begins with an evaluation of ingredients, equipment, and production methods by a recognized kosher authority. Auditors assess whether the facility follows kosher guidelines, which may include modifying cleaning procedures, adjusting production lines, or sourcing approved ingredients. Manufacturers must maintain detailed documentation and follow specific operational protocols. Once the facility meets all requirements, it receives kosher certification, typically followed by periodic inspections to ensure continuous compliance. With proper guidance, Malaysian companies can complete the process smoothly and align their operations with global kosher expectations.
